Nelson J Shelton

May 23, 1947 — January 3, 2012

Nelson Jay Shelton, 64, of Vienna passed away Tuesday, January 3, 2012 at Hospice House with his two brothers, Randy and Kevin at his side. Nelson was born May 23, 1947 in Morgantown, W.Va., the son of Edward and Virginia Shelton. He graduated from Lakeview High School in Cortland, Ohio in the class of 1965. Nelson was a retired truck driver for John Rebhan and Gary Bauer. At the young age of 18 he proudly served in the U.S. Army with a one year tour in Vietnam. Nelson was a member of the VFW, Amvets and was a 32nd degree Mason. He was a humble man and had a heart made of gold. Nelson walked through life with the same quiet confidence as his Dad. He never asked for anything and would not hesitate to lend a hand to anyone who needed it. His strong work ethic started at the early age of 10, delivering newspapers and continued throughout his adult life. He loved dancing, NASCAR racing and vintage cars. Nelson is survived by his Mom, Virginia Shelton of Howland, brother and sister-in-law, Randy & Carol Shelton of Fowler, brother and sister-in-law, Kevin & Colleen Shelton of Howland with whom he made his home the last weeks of his life and sister and brother-in-law, Debbie & Patrick Dobozy of Howland; nephews, Ryan (Nicole) Allison, Shawn (Kerry) Shelton and Jason & Justin Shelton; nieces, Jaime (Matt) Wagner and Shannon Shelton; Great-nephews, George Nelson Wagner, his newest name sake, Owen, Arran, Jack, Noah, Luke and Ethan; Great-nieces, Emily and Grace. Nelson will be also greatly missed by his former wife and dear friend, Evelyn Shelton along with her daughters, Renee and Michelle and family. He looked so forward to their visits and good times. Nelson was preceded in death by his wonderful Dad, Edward Shelton.
